Private Assets FY26 H1 net loss narrows to EUR 6.4 million; revenue rises 18.9% to EUR 90.1 million
  • Private Assets reported H1 2026 revenue up 18.9% to EUR 90.1 million.
  • EBITDA loss narrowed to EUR 0.9 million from EUR 1.6 million a year earlier.
  • Net loss improved to EUR 6.4 million from EUR 6.7 million.
  • Equity ratio slipped to 13.7% at June 30, 2026, down 0.9 percentage points year on year.
  • Management flagged a tough environment and project delays in Automation & Technology; cited Industrial progress, TAM Groupe integration on track, and a stronger order intake.
